The ‘Fragmented Memory’ series comprises two-plate copper etchings that aim to record the intricate nature of memory storage within an individual. As time elapses and our minds accumulate and recall an ever-increasing number of memories, certain memories undergo fragmentation, division, and at times, become so familiar that they undergo alterations. The symbol used in this series holds a profound significance, having accompanied me for decades and is used to describe a specific point in time both emotionally and geographically.
